Napoleon III's Legitimacy Questioned by Genetic Testing

Genetic testing conducted in the 2010s suggests that Napoleon III may not have been the biological son of Louis Bonaparte. This finding stems from his mother, Hortense de Beauharnais, having had numerous affairs during her marriage.
